Wilf Takes One from Dvoress

Level 4 : 100/300, 300 ante

Saar Wilf opened to 800 from the hijack. Daniel Dvoress called from the button and Niall Farrell defended his big blind.

Action checked through on the {a-Clubs}{9-Clubs}{5-Diamonds} flop to the {9-Diamonds} turn. Dvoress took the lead and bet 2,500, only Wilf called.

Action checked through on the {k-Clubs} river and Wilf's {a-Spades}{6-Diamonds} was the winner.

Colillas Stack Heading in Right Direction

Level 4 : 100/300, 300 ante

With 5,000 in the pot on the {8-Clubs}{3-Diamonds}{2-Clubs} flop, Renan Bruschi checked in early position before Ramon Colillas bet 2,500 from middle position.

Bruschi called which brought in the {k-Hearts} turn. Bruschi check-called a bet of 3,500 before both players checked on the {k-Diamonds} river.

Bruschi missed his flush draw as he had the {j-Clubs}{10-Clubs} while Colillas scooped the pot with {a-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}.

Stakelis Survives Baltaci's Blender

Level 4 : 100/300, 300 ante

Action was picked up with Audrius Stakelis facing a river bet from Firat Baltaci for the rest of his 43,000 chip stack.

The board read {q-Spades}{7-Clubs}{6-Hearts}{q-Diamonds}{a-Hearts}, and Stakelis went deep into the tank, facing a decision for his tournament life.

After using all but one of his time bank cards, Stakelis made the call and was thrilled to see Baltaci turn over {5-Diamonds}{5-Clubs}. Stakelis showed {k-Spades}{q-Spades} for trip queens to earn a double up to over 100,000 chips.

Grafton and Kisacikoglu at it Again

Level 3 : 100/300, 300 ante

Sam Grafton and Orpen Kisacikoglu finished second and fourth respectively in Sunday's €25,000 Single-Day High Roller, and after battling each other much of yesterday, they're seated beside each other in today's event.

In a recent pot, Kisacikoglu opened for 900 on the button and Grafton then three-bet him to 4,500 from the small blind. Kisacikoglu folded and the pot was pushed to the PokerStars Ambassador.

Just another day of battling on the EPT High Roller scene.

Guilbert Fires All Three Streets

Level 3 : 100/300, 300 ante
Johan Guilbert
Johan Guilbert

Panagiotis Oikonomou opened under the gun and was three-bet to 2,600 by Johan Guilbert immediately to his left. Oikonomou called to see a flop of {j-Diamonds}{3-Diamonds}{5-Clubs} and checked.

Guilbert methodically put forward a bet of 2,100, which Oikonomou called.

On the {j-Spades} turn, Oikonomou checked again and was this time faced with a bet of 3,600. Again, Oikonomou called.

The river brought the {5-Hearts} and once more Oikonomou checked. One final time, Guilbert put out a bet, this time for 11,500. After some brief deliberation, Oikonomou opted to fold, giving Guilbert a pot that brings him back to near his starting stack after a slow start.

Brandstrom Edges Out Muehloecker; Colillas Joins HIgh Roller

Level 3 : 100/300, 300 ante

Simon Brandstrom opened to 700 from the button and was called by big blind Thomas Muehloecker.

Muehloecker check-called a bet of 600 on the {k-Diamonds}{j-Spades}{8-Diamonds} flop before the {3-Spades} turn was checked through to the {j-Hearts} river. Muehloecker took the lead and bet 2,000. Brandstrom used a time bank card and then raised to 11,000.

Muehloecker looked unfazzed but then decided to fold his hand.

Ramon Colillas was also one of the entrants after the break and has taken a seat at the same table.
